By Adam Rittenberg & Kyle Bonagura: Nearly six years after his mother vanished, Paul Wulff sat across from the man his family strongly believed had murdered her.
It was March 1985, and Paul, then 18, had been summoned to a meeting that possibly represented his family’s final hope for justice. His mother’s body had never been found.
